Guide to Greatness: Step-by-Step to Formulating Your Personal Mission Statement
So, where do you start? First, grab a cozy spot and a notebook—this is your creative space! Begin by jotting down what really matters to you. Is it family, adventure, creativity, or helping others? Think of it like listing your favorite toppings for a pizza; you want only what you truly love. Next, dive deeper. Ask yourself questions like, “What skills do I want to develop?” or “How do I want to impact my community?” These reflections are vital, almost like breadcrumbs leading you to your path.
Once you have your thoughts penned down, it’s time to identify patterns. Do certain themes keep popping up? It’s like spotting a recurring motif in your favorite movie; it reveals what truly resonates with your soul. After this, craft a concise statement. Keep it clear and powerful—think of it as your personal mantra. You want it to be memorable, something you can hang onto like a lifeline during tough times.
Finally, don’t let it gather dust! Revisit and revise your mission statement regularly. Life evolves, and so should your vision. Just like a tree grows and changes with the seasons, your mission statement should reflect your journey. Trust me, embracing this process will shine light on your path to greatness!

Frequently Asked Questions
How often should I revise my personal mission statement?
Review your personal mission statement at least once a year to ensure it aligns with your evolving goals and values. Regularly revisiting it can help you stay focused and adjust to any life changes.
How do I create a personal mission statement?
A personal mission statement defines your core values and goals, guiding your decisions and actions. To create one, reflect on your passions, strengths, and beliefs. Combine these elements into a concise statement that encapsulates your purpose and aspirations. Revise it often to align with your evolving priorities.
What should I include in my personal mission statement?
A personal mission statement should include your core values, life goals, and the purpose that drives you. Focus on what is most important to you, such as relationships, career aspirations, and personal growth. Aim to express your unique vision for how you want to live and contribute to the world.
What is a personal mission statement and why is it important?
A personal mission statement is a brief declaration of an individual’s core values, goals, and purpose in life. It serves as a guiding compass, helping to align decisions, actions, and aspirations with one’s true self. Having a clear mission statement is important as it provides focus, motivates personal growth, and enhances decision-making, ultimately leading to a more fulfilling life.
How can I use my personal mission statement in daily life?
To effectively incorporate your personal mission statement into daily life, regularly review it to remind yourself of your goals and values. Align your daily activities and decisions with the principles outlined in your statement. Use it as a guide during challenging situations to maintain focus and motivation. Consider setting specific, actionable objectives that are in harmony with your mission to ensure consistent progress.
